Chromium – Performante Web-HMIs für Embedded Linux

Web-Technologien haben sich als leistungsstarke Alternative zur klassischen GUI-Entwicklung etabliert. Mit Chromium (der Open-Source-Basis von Google Chrome) bringen Sie Frameworks wie React, Vue oder Angular direkt auf Ihre Embedded-Geräte. Die Integration eines vollwertigen Browsers in ein schlankes Embedded-Linux-System ist jedoch hochkomplex und erfordert tiefe Yocto- und Hardware-Kenntnisse. Genau hier unterstützen wir Sie: Profitieren Sie von der tiefgehenden Expertise unserer FAEs (Field Application Engineers), um Chromium hardwarebeschleunigt und stabil auf PHYTEC-Hardware lauffähig zu machen.

Warum Web-Grafik auf Embedded?

Die Zeiten, in denen Browser-Engines zu ressourcenhungrig für Embedded-Geräte waren, sind vorbei. Moderne SoCs bieten dedizierte Grafikeinheiten (GPUs), die das Rendering von HTML5, CSS3 und WebGL hocheffizient übernehmen. Chromium ist dabei der De-facto-Standard, um diese Leistung abzurufen.

Warum sollten Sie Web-HMIs für Embedded Projekte nutzen?

✓ Plattformunabhängigkeit

Entwickeln Sie Ihre Benutzeroberfläche genau einmal. Die gleiche UI läuft auf dem Embedded-Gerät am Touch-Display, auf dem PC des Servicetechnikers oder auf dem Smartphone des Endkunden.

✓ Schnellere Time-to-Market

Profitieren Sie von einem gigantischen Ökosystem an Web-Entwicklern, vorgefertigten UI-Komponenten (z.B. Material Design) und Open-Source-Bibliotheken, anstatt mühsam in komplexem C/C++ zu programmieren.

✓ Flexible Architektur (Lokal oder Online)

Web-HMIs können völlig autark über einen lokalen, leichtgewichtigen Webserver (z.B. Nginx) auf dem PHYTEC-Gerät laufen oder nahtlos Daten aus der Cloud als Edge-Gateway visualisieren.

✓ Einfache OTA-Updates

Die Trennung von Betriebssystem und Applikation macht Updates extrem sicher und schnell. Das Aktualisieren der Benutzeroberfläche erfordert kein komplettes Firmware-Update mehr, sondern oft nur den Austausch kompakter lokaler HTML/JS-Dateien.

Die Herausforderung: Chromium-Integration meistern

Die reine Theorie klingt einfach, die Praxis unter Yocto sieht oft anders aus: Chromium ist eines der größten und komplexesten Software-Pakete der Open-Source-Welt. Es zu kompilieren, die Yocto-Abhängigkeiten aufzulösen und – am wichtigsten – die Hardware-Beschleunigung (VPU/GPU) über Wayland korrekt zu aktivieren, kostet Entwickler-Teams oft Wochen.

Unsere Expertise für Ihr Projekt:
Wir lassen Sie bei dieser Herausforderung nicht allein. PHYTEC verfügt über tiefgehendes Inhouse-Know-how bei der Chromium-Integration. Unsere Field Application Engineers haben bereits erfolgreich performante Kiosk-Mode-Lösungen (Fullscreen ohne Browser-Leisten) auf unseren Modulen realisiert und die Hardware-Ressourcen optimal ausgereizt. Sprechen Sie uns an – wir beraten Sie gerne zur Architektur, zur richtigen Hardware-Auswahl und zu Integrations-Best-Practices.

Empfohlene Hardware

Für Chromium-basierte Web-HMIs empfehlen wir Hardware mit einer leistungsstarken 3D-GPU, um das Rendering effizient auszulagern:

Unser Preis-Leistungs-Sieger für Web-Grafik. Die Architektur liefert überraschend starke Benchmark-Ergebnisse beim Browser-Rendering.

Das Komplettpaket für den Schnellstart: Modul, Baseboard und ein 10" Touch-Display mit vorinstalliertem Chromium-Image.

Die leistungsstarke Alternative für Projekte, die neben der Web-HMI zusätzlich NPU-Power (z.B. für Machine Learning) benötigen.

Möchten Sie mehr über Chromium auf PHYTEC-Hardware erfahren?
Vereinbaren Sie eine kostenlose Beratung durch unsere Experten. Wir freuen uns auf Sie.

Martin Podolszki
Head of FAE